Rex ( blondie) is a male approx two and Suki is female and approx one. They have become great mates and we will try and re-home them together. Rex 's owner is unwell, and was very sad to have to let him go and little Suki was most probably dumped - she was thin, cold and stressed when I found her wandering the streets.They have both just had their operations and will be vaccinated soon. They're accommodation here is a renovated outbuilding and they both appear to be fully house trained. There has been a bit of chewing of their cushions but otherwise they are very good inside. They both love human company and are very affectionate.They are young and full of beans and so will require a secure garden and lots of exercise. They both get on grand with our other dogs. Rex is a mighty little guy and would fit in anywhere. Suki is a little more serious, very clever and Rex seems to have a nice calming effect on her, as she can get a bit excited up here with all of our gang. I would be a little wary of her around very young children as she has the "rounding up" instinct and has been known to give some of our more flighty dogs a small nip or two.
